Complete Description
The North Carolina Department of Health and Human Services (NC DHHS) is seeking a Senior Application Systems Analyst and Designer to help us with implementing solutions around the HR1 and payment error rate reduction changes for FNS/SNAP programs. The responsibilities of this role will include the following:
Gather and evaluate user requirements in collaboration with product owners and engineers.
Document and illustrate design ideas using POCs.
Design graphic user interface elements, like menus, tabs and widgets.
Build page navigation buttons and search fields.
Develop UI mockups and prototypes that clearly illustrate how sites function and look like.
Prepare and present rough drafts to internal teams and key stakeholders.
Conduct layout adjustments based on user feedback.
Help creating user stories based on the application design
Help creating test scenarios and help test in some scenarios
This role will work with the NCFAST Food Nutrition Services (FNS/SNAP) teams for gathering requirements, designing application components based on the HR1 and Payment error rate reduction/Proactive QC efforts. This role will collaborate with other members of the application development team, NC FAST business team, and the division and county stake holders for design, development and testing of the code as per the business requirement.
